Default What shoes do you train in?

Hi guys!
It's time for me to get a new pair of gym shoes and I was just wondering what you all wear when you're lifting (I'm thinking squats, specifically). When I had a trainer I was using Nike Shox because they were really good for plyometric moves, but now that I am on my own and lifting heavy again I find the "spring" in the back makes my heel too unstable when I squat. Right now I'm using the Asics shoes that I run in, but I would like to have some specifically for lifting. Any suggestions?

I train in a pair of wrestling shoes. They are flat, and offer absolutely no support, other than the fact they are 3/4 high top. The reason I got these is for squats, and other leg work. I like the barefoot feeling squatting. Lately I've been wearing a decent pair of cross trainers, but today I squatted and missed my wrestling shoes. These shoes are for indoors only, so make sure you dont wear them outside!
